Anxiety gripped locals in Uttar Pradesh’s Greater Noida on Saturday as they noticed a strange flying object in the sky, that turned out to be an Iron man-shaped balloon, PTI reported.

The object was spotted in the sky in the Dankaur area in the morning and later landed in a canal near Bhatta Parsaul village, where a crowd had gathered to see what some of them thought was “an alien”, officials said, PTI reported.

“It was a balloon filled with air that had gone up in the sky,” Dankaur SHO Anil Kumar Pandey told PTI.

It later came down and got stuck in the bushes along a canal.

“A part of the balloon was touching the flowing water in the canal which had led the balloon to shake a little. Unbeknown to the spectators, this made for an anxious watch,” the officer said.

The SHO said a major reason behind the anxiety among people was the unusual shape of the balloon.

“It was shaped like the Ironman (fictional superhero character) given its colour and design. This was an unusual sight so some people even thought it was an alien, or something like that, and were apprehensive,” Pandey said.

On Saturday, “a robot-shaped balloon was spotted, that was filled with air. It came down after losing gas,” the Noida Police tweeted.

There was nothing harmful in the object but it was yet to be ascertained who floated it in the air, the SHO said.
